Fairy Chimneys

The first sight that greets visitors to Cappadocia is the mesmerizing landscape of fairy chimneys. These peculiar rock formations, shaped by volcanic ash and erosion over millions of years, stand tall like whimsical towers. The fairy chimneys create an otherworldly atmosphere, transporting visitors to a land straight out of a fairy tale. Exploring the intricate network of caves and tunnels within these formations is a surreal experience that adds to the strangeness and allure of Cappadocia.

Underground Cities

Beneath the surface of Cappadocia lie ancient underground cities, yet another testament to the strangeness of this region. Carved out of the soft volcanic rock, these hidden cities served as a refuge for early settlers, offering protection from invaders and harsh weather conditions. The labyrinthine tunnels, secret chambers, and intricate ventilation systems within these cities provide a glimpse into the ingenuity and resilience of the people who once called Cappadocia home.

The Cave Dwellings

Cappadocia is also renowned for its unique cave dwellings, which have been inhabited for centuries. These natural caves, hollowed out of the soft volcanic rock, served as homes, churches, and even monasteries. Walking through the narrow passages and exploring the well-preserved frescoes adorning the cave walls is like stepping back in time. The ghostly silence and the sense of history that permeate these dwellings add to the overall strangeness and charm of Cappadocia.

Hot Air Balloons

One of the most iconic images associated with Cappadocia is the spectacle of hot air balloons floating above the surreal landscape at sunrise. The sight of dozens of colorful balloons drifting gracefully amidst the fairy chimneys is truly breathtaking. Taking a hot air balloon ride over Cappadocia offers a unique perspective, allowing visitors to witness the strangeness of this region from the sky, as the morning light bathes the landscape in a warm glow.
